Title:
INTRAORAL VIBRATION-IMPARTING DEVICE
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2016/199925
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
This intraoral vibration-imparting device (1) is provided with: a tooth-row contacting portion (60) to be brought into direct contact with rows of teeth (T) of a user; a vibrator (11) which causes the tooth-row contacting portion (60) to vibrate; a vibration generating portion (31) which generates an electrical signal causing the vibrator (11) to generate ultrasonic vibrations; an electric heating wire (67) for applying heat to the tooth-row contacting portion (60); a heating control portion (32) which generates an electric current causing the electric heating wire (67) to emit heat; a control means (33) for controlling the vibration generating portion (31) and the heating control portion (32); a power supply unit (35) which supplies power for driving the vibration generating portion (31), the heating control portion (32) and the control means (33); and an operation portion (37) which is operated by a user. The configuration is such that the ultrasonic vibrations from the tooth-row contacting portion (60) propagate into the oral cavity via the rows of teeth (T).
